What is PVC?


PVC is one of the most popular synthetic plastic polymers in the world. It is produced through the polymerization of vinyl chloride monomers. PVC can be made rigid or flexible, depending on the additives used during its manufacturing process. Rigid PVC is extensively used for pipes, doors, and windows, while flexible PVC is commonly found in products such as flooring, packaging, and films. The material is known for its durability, strength, and resistance to rotting, corrosion, and chemical damage.


Characteristics of PVC Plastic Sheet Rolls


PVC plastic sheet rolls come in a variety of thicknesses, colors, and finishes, making them suitable for diverse applications. Some of the key characteristics of PVC plastic sheets include


1. Durability PVC sheets are highly resistant to impact, making them suitable for both indoor and outdoor use. Their durability ensures longevity, reducing the need for frequent replacements.


2. Weather Resistance The inherent properties of PVC make it resistant to UV radiation, moisture, and temperature changes. This makes it a preferred choice for outdoor applications like signage and cladding.


3. Chemical Resistance PVC sheets can withstand many chemicals and acids, making them ideal for laboratory settings and industrial applications.


4. Ease of Fabrication PVC can be easily cut, drilled, and shaped, allowing for a wide range of customizations to meet specific project requirements.

5. Cost-Effectiveness Compared to other materials, PVC is generally more affordable, which can significantly reduce overall project costs.


Applications of PVC Plastic Sheet Rolls


The versatility of PVC plastic sheet rolls allows them to be used in various applications, such as


- Signage PVC is a popular choice for indoor and outdoor signs due to its weather-resistant properties and excellent printability. Businesses often use PVC sheets to create eye-catching advertisements and promotional materials.


- Construction In the building industry, PVC sheets are used for wall cladding, roofing sheets, window frames, and even flooring. Their resilience against moisture and termites makes them a preferred option for construction projects.


- Display and Decoration Retailers often use PVC sheets for displays and decorative elements. They can be easily printed with graphics, making them perfect for product showcases.


- Packaging Due to its transparency and moisture resistance, PVC is commonly used in packaging applications, including food packaging and protective covers for various products.


- DIY Projects DIY enthusiasts frequently use PVC plastic sheets for crafting, modeling, and home improvement projects. Their ease of use makes them ideal for personalized creations.
